Common Wasp - The Common Wasp, Vespula vulgaris is a wasp found in much of the Northern Hemisphere, and introduced to Australia and New Zealand. It is a paper wasp, which builds its grey paper nest underground, sometimes using an abandoned mammal hole as a start for the site, which is then enlarged by the workers. Paper wasp - Despite the use of the proper name, most social wasps make nests from paper, although some tropical wasp species such as Listenogaster flavolineata use mud, a far more easy resource for the wasp to collect. The larger colonial species, Yellowjackets, Hornets, can be very defensive and should not be approached unless one is experienced. Cicada Killer Wasp - The Cicada Killer Wasp is a large, solitary wasp. It is so named because is hunts cicadas and provisions its nest with them.
